After a bit of fiddling and pedal swapping this week I have arrived with a
combination as follows:
Overdrive:
a) mild, bluesy overdrive via Digitech Bad Monkey (can crank up a little if
required).
b) Visual Sounds Jeckyl & Hyde on the Jeckyl side with about 50% overdrive,
gives a reasonable Thin Lizzy-Jailbreak era tone, maybe a bit of Bachman
Turner Overdrive (pun not intended and I apologise for the reference to a
cheesy band).
c) Digitech Distortion Factory on the Tubescreamer setting with very low
gain and a scooped low/mid/high setting, gives an mildly overdriven sound
with very little colouring to the original tone.
Distortion:
Visual Sounds Jeckyl & Hyde on the Hyde side with gain at 75%. Heaps of
distortion but a great clear tone (somehow).
Signal provided by Gibson Les Paul Studio, amplified by Fender Hot Rod
Deluxe.
